Medical Tape Adhesion Test>
Adhesion of medical tape usually requires the use of a peeling tester To perform the test, the test principle is to stick the tape to the test plate, and then peel off the jaws of the strength tester to pinch a section of the tape, and perform a stretching movement at 90° or 180° with the test board, and calculate the peel time by the load cell the magnitude of the tensile force.
The specific operation is wie follows:
1. Prepare a peel strength tester in advance. (Our company can use YG090Electronic Peeling Tester to test adhesive tape adhesion)
2. Using a sampling knife, cut out suitable sample, tape sample length is generally about 35cm. Prepare 20-40 samples for backup.
3. Stick the tape pattern on the test board, fix the test board on the lower jaw and form an angle of 90° or sothe 180° with the direction of movement of the upper jaw jaw according to the test requirements.
4. Fix the end of the band near the upper jaw in the jaw of the upper jaw, clear all the data on the control panel, and then start stretching.
5. Write down the test value and the program will automatically calculate the average value. The mean value is the actual adhesion value of the tape.
